In 2008, I went to Orlando Florida and stayed at the Westgate Resort. We went to many popular Orlando parks including Sea World, Animal Kingdom, Universal Studios, Wet n’ wild and Aquatica. My favorite parks were the water parks. Even though I can’t remember much about my visit to the parks, I do remember small details. I remember  Wet n wild because it was the most exciting water park I have ever gone to.

Wet n wild is known for its giant bubble and has the largest family water play area in Florida. This park has multiple people rides, single person rides and easy going water attractions and activities. It has something for all ages.

I remember going on the Bomb Bay. It’s a straight down vertical slide. I remember riding this at least twice. When getting on the ride people stand on a trap door. The trap door then opens to a 76 foot drop. After the trap door is opened people slide down the slide in a matter of seconds. The trill is the most exciting part of the ride. Once people ride it after the first time it isn’t as much fun from my experience.

The Black Hole: The next generation was the ride I was the most scared to go on. I remember thinking that it was a spaceship octopus. The whole ride is dark like a black hole. I thought it was going to be like the moon ride at Delgrosso’s Amusement Park. I was wrong. It was scarier and was an adventure I will never forget.

The new attraction that I want to see is the Blastaway Beach. Even though it is mostly for little kids, I just want to see the castle and everything it has to offer. It has a 60 foot castle, and 15 water slides. I hope to go back to this water park in my future
